GitLab Runner: 1. Authentification

Cette documentation fait partie du guide Automatiser avec la CLI. Consultez le guide complet ici : Démarrez GitLab-Runner, récupérez ses identifiants et modifiez sa configuration par programmation avec la CLI Stackhero.

👋 Bienvenue sur la documentation de Stackhero !

Stackhero vous propose une solution GitLab Runner cloud simple à utiliser, conçue pour exécuter efficacement vos jobs GitLab CI/CD. Voici ce dont vous pouvez bénéficier :

  • Minutes CI/CD illimitées : aucune facturation à la minute, vos pipelines s'exécutent quand vous en avez besoin.
  • Jobs simultanés : lancez plusieurs jobs en parallèle pour accélérer l'ensemble de votre pipeline.
  • Docker executor avec prise en charge de Docker-in-Docker : facilitez la création et le push de vos images de conteneurs.
  • Compatible avec GitLab.com ainsi que toute instance GitLab auto-hébergée.
  • Une VM privée et dédiée propulsée par des disques NVMe/SSD rapides pour des builds fiables et constants.
  • Disponible dans les régions 🇪🇺 Europe et 🇺🇸 USA.

Gagnez du temps : connectez votre premier GitLab Runner et lancez vos pipelines en quelques minutes seulement !

La façon la plus simple de commencer est de vous connecter via votre navigateur. Lorsque vous lancez la commande de connexion, la CLI ouvre une page web où vous pouvez approuver l'accès. Aucun mot de passe ni code 2FA n'est saisi dans la CLI elle-même.

stackhero login

Après la connexion, vos identifiants sont stockés localement et seront utilisés automatiquement par les prochaines commandes CLI.

Pour les environnements entièrement automatisés comme les scripts ou les pipelines CI, vous pouvez préférer un jeton d'accès non interactif. Vous pouvez en créer un depuis votre tableau de bord (Compte > Access tokens), puis l'exporter comme variable d'environnement. La CLI, ainsi que tout script que vous exécutez, le détectera automatiquement.

export STACKHERO_TOKEN="usr-xxxxxx:your-token"